✓ Decided: Council approves $500K airport grant application and fire code update
Council approved three agenda additions and then passed several items, including an emergency ordinance updating the International Fire Code (16-2026), a resolution authorizing the mayor to apply for a $500,000 ODOT aviation grant for a new T-hangar (6-2026), and two resolutions related to tax levies (18-2026 and 19-2026). Ordinance 17-2026, authorizing a loan application for a paving project on Front Ave. SW, received first reading but was not voted on. The meeting also included reports on audits, income tax collections, and a discussion about possibly outsourcing the income tax department to RITA, but no decision was made on that matter.
- Approved Ordinance 16-2026 updating the International Fire Code (6-0)
- Approved Resolution 6-2026 authorizing mayor to submit $500,000 ODOT aviation grant application for T-hangar construction (6-0)
- Approved Resolution 18-2026 requesting certification from county auditor for tax levy (5-1)
- Approved Resolution 19-2026 to proceed as taxing authority (5-1)
- Added Resolution 6-2026, Ordinance 16-2026, and Ordinance 17-2026 to agenda (6-0, 6-0, 5-1)
- Approved minutes from July 13, 2026 regular session (6-0)

City Council
✓ Decided: Council approves traffic safety ordinance and garage sale fee change
New Philadelphia City Council approved two ordinances on third reading: Ordinance 4-2026 amends the traffic code to prohibit overtaking and passing on the right in a specified area during restricted hours on school days for safety reasons, and Ordinance 10-2026 amends the garage sale permit fee. Both were declared emergencies and passed 6-0. No other substantive decisions were made; the meeting included reports on state funding, income tax collections, and recognition of the high school track team's state championship.
- Approved Ordinance 4-2026 amending traffic code to prohibit overtaking/passing on right in specified area during restricted school-day hours (6-0)
- Approved Ordinance 10-2026 amending garage sale permit fee (6-0)
- Approved meeting agenda (6-0)
- Approved minutes of May 28, 2026 regular session (6-0)

City Council
✓ Decided: Council approved airport hangar loan application and alley vacation
New Philadelphia City Council approved several items including an ordinance authorizing the mayor to apply for an ODOT State Infrastructure Bank loan to finance construction of a 12-bay nested T-hangar at Harry Clever Airport (5-1), and an ordinance vacating an unnamed alley on Meadowbrook Drive SW (6-0). Council also approved resolutions for municipal services for two annexations on Hillandale Road NE and six 'then and now' certificates for expenditures. The meeting included reports on e-bike policy development, a $300,000 Brownfield grant for the Joy/Howden property, and the opening of Hobby Lobby at New Towne Mall.
- Approved Ordinance 12-2026 authorizing ODOT SIB loan application for airport hangar construction (5-1)
- Approved Ordinance 13-2026 vacating unnamed alley on Meadowbrook Drive SW (6-0)
- Approved Resolution 5-2026 authorizing NatureWorks grant application (5-1)
- Approved Resolution 7-2026 for municipal services upon annexation of parcel 25-00007.000 (6-0)
- Approved Resolution 8-2026 for municipal services upon annexation of parcels 25-00295.000, .001, .002 (6-0)
- Approved Resolutions 9-2026 through 14-2026, six 'then and now' certificates for expenditures (6-0 each)
- Approved minutes from May 11, 2026 regular session (6-0)
- Added ordinances 12-2026 and 13-2026 and resolutions 7-2026 through 14-2026 to agenda (6-0 each)
